Fulham are working on a new contract for Nigeria international Calvin Bassey as the club looks to tie down one of its key defenders for the long term.

Existing Deal And New Terms

Bassey currently has a year left on his contract at Craven Cottage, though Fulham hold an option to trigger a further one year extension that would keep him at the club until the summer of 2028. Reports indicate the Cottagers are now prepared to go further and offer the 26 year old centre back a fresh long term deal to secure his future.

A Key Figure At The Back

Bassey has grown into one of the Premier League’s most dependable defenders since his move from Ajax in July 2023, and was named Fulham’s Player of the Season for 2024/25. He has started all three of the club’s league matches so far this season under new manager Alvaro Arbeloa, taking his total appearances for Fulham across all competitions to 105.
